本文将探讨网站性能监控的重要性及如何利用Lighthouse进行优化,详细阐述性能监控的关键方面,包括监测响应时间、资源加载情况和错误率等,介绍Lighthouse的核心功能和评分准则,通过实际案例分析,展示如何根据Lighthouse报告调整网页设计、提升加载速度和增强交互性,提供维护优化策略和工具,以提升网站性能和用户体验。,深入研究性能监控与Lighthouse优化建议,对于提升网站质量具有重要意义。
随着互联网的普及和技术的飞速发展,网站已经渗透到我们生活的方方面面,在享受网络服务的同时,不少网站却因为性能问题而影响了用户体验,为了帮助大家更好地理解和改善网站性能,本文将重点介绍网站性能监控以及Lighthouse优化建议。
网站性能监控的重要性
在当前竞争激烈的网络环境中,拥有快速且稳定的网站是吸引和留住用户的关键,网站性能监控能实时收集网站的各项性能指标,及时发现并解决潜在的性能瓶颈,确保网站在不同设备和网络环境下都能提供良好的用户体验。
Lighthouse优化建议
Lighthouse是一款开源的自动化工具,用于改进网页的质量,它不仅可以评估网站的性能,还能从多个维度给出优化建议,以下是一些Lighthouse常见的优化建议:
减少 HTTP 请求
-
合并 CSS 和 JavaScript 文件,减少页面加载时的请求次数。
-
利用 CSS Sprites 技术合并图片请求,节约带宽。
优化 CSS 和 JavaScript 文件
-
压缩和混淆 CSS 和 JavaScript 文件,减小文件大小。
-
延迟加载非关键资源的加载顺序,提高首屏加载速度。
图片优化
-
使用适当的图片格式(如 WebP)以减少文件大小。
-
根据设备屏幕大小和分辨率提供不同尺寸的图片。
-
利用懒加载技术,在用户滚动页面时才加载图片。
使用 CDN 加速资源加载
将静态资源部署到 CDN 上,加速全球用户的访问速度。
服务器端渲染 (SSR) 或预渲染
对于动态渲染的网页,采用 SSR 或预渲染可以加快首屏渲染速度,提高用户体验。
缓存策略
合理设置 HTTP 缓存头,让浏览器缓存静态资源,降低服务器压力。
代码分割与懒加载
将代码分割成多个小块,并按需加载,提高首屏加载速度。
实施 Lighthouse 测试与优化
在实际操作中,我们可以借助一些自动化工具来辅助进行 Lighthouse 的测试,使用 WebPageTest、Lighthouse CLI 或 Chrome DevTools 进行测试,记录性能数据,并根据 Lighthouse 提出的优化建议逐一改进。
除了上述基本优化措施外,还应关注网站的安全性、可用性和语义化等问题,全方位提升网站的整体质量。
网站性能监控与优化是一个持续的过程,它不仅关乎用户体验,更直接影响到网站的长期运营和成功,作为网站开发者或管理者,我们应该不断学习和应用最新的技术和方法,努力提升网站的性能和用户体验。
通过定期进行性能监控、实施 Lighthouse 优化建议,并结合实际情况进行调整和改进,我们可以确保网站在激烈的市场竞争中保持领先地位,为企业和用户创造更大的价值。


还没有评论,来说两句吧...